SRINAGAR, Aug 28: Julia Morley, the Chairman and CEO of Miss World Organisation, has tagged Kashmir as a blessed place for tourism.
During the 71st Miss World press conference held at SKICC as per Kashmir Despatch Correspondent Morley expressed her delight at the warm reception and hospitality extended by the locals.

Misss World Karolina Bielawska along with Miss World India Sini Shetty and Miss World Caribbean Emmy Pena visited Kashmir on Monday. This is the first-ever visit of any Miss World in Jammu and Kashmir.
As per Kashmir Despatch Correspondent, the celebrities also interacted with some locals and enjoyed their hospitality. Miss World Karolina Bielawska is a Polish model, television presenter, television personality, social activist, UN Messenger of Peace Goodwill Ambassador, philanthropist publicist, and beauty queen who was crowned Miss World 2021.
